Cs 1.6 Ak-47 No Recoil Cfg Today
In Counter-Strike 1.6, the AK-47 is the most powerful rifle for Terrorists, but its high recoil makes it difficult to master. Many players search for a "no recoil CFG" to eliminate the weapon's kick. Here’s the technical truth.
The AK-47's spray pattern is hardcoded into the server. It consists of:
No legal console command (cl_pitchspeed, cl_pitchdown, etc.) can override this. Any CFG claiming "real no recoil" is either:
A CFG (configuration file) is a text script that can automate console commands. A true "no recoil" effect cannot be achieved with a simple CFG on standard, unmodified CS 1.6 (non-steam or steam) because recoil is calculated by the game engine, not adjustable via user settings.
However, some scripts claim to reduce or compensate for recoil. These generally fall into two categories:
Using a no-recoil CFG is effectively cheating. It robs you of the skill that makes CS 1.6 legendary. The AK-47's difficulty is its beauty. Every veteran player remembers the months of practice to spray down a rushing enemy at 30 meters. Scripts cannot replicate that satisfaction.
Let's settle the debate with technical precision:
The quest for the CS 1.6 AK-47 No Recoil CFG is a rite of passage for every new player. We have all been there—frustrated as the golden rifle kicks toward the sky while a Desert Eagle domes you from long A.
But here is the truth: The most dangerous AK-47 players in history (HeatoN, trace, markeloff) used default configs or very minor rate adjustments. Their "no recoil" was 200ms reaction times and a mousepad worn down from thousands of hours of pulling down.
Delete the sketchy scripts. Set your m_pitch back to 0.022. Breathe. Aim for the neck. Burst two bullets. If you miss, strafe, reset, and fire again.
That is the real .cfg you need: Discipline.cfg.
Do you have a working recoil script? Share it in the comments (at your own risk). Or, join our Discord to learn real AK-47 spray control from veteran 1.6 players.
[Next Article: How to Bhop Like Phoon Without Getting Banned] [Download: Pro League Legal Rate Settings for CS 1.6]
Finding a "no recoil" configuration (CFG) for the AK-47 in Counter-Strike 1.6 is a common goal for players looking to improve their accuracy. However, it is important to clarify that
true "no recoil" (where bullets hit the exact same spot without moving the mouse) is not possible through a standard .cfg file alone Cs 1.6 Ak-47 No Recoil Cfg
Recoil in CS 1.6 is hard-coded into the game engine. A legitimate CFG can only
your settings to make recoil more predictable and easier to control. Optimized AK-47 Recoil Settings You can add these commands to your userconfig.cfg config.cfg file to improve the "feel" and registration of your shots: Rate Settings (For better hit registration): rate 25000 cl_updaterate 101 cl_cmdrate 101 ex_interp 0.01
(Essential for seeing player models where they actually are) Mouse & Performance (For smoother aiming): m_filter 0 (Disables mouse smoothing for raw input feel) fps_max 101
(Syncs game logic with the standard competitive engine speed) cl_corpsestay 0 (Can slightly improve recoil feel by reducing clutter) Crosshair Behavior: cl_dynamiccrosshair 0
(Prevents the crosshair from expanding while moving, helping you focus on the center point) How to "Control" Recoil Manually Since a CFG won't do the work for you, you must use the Pull-Down Technique . For the AK-47: First 2-3 bullets: Very accurate. Aim for the head. Bullets 4-10: The gun kicks straight up. Pull your mouse down Bullets 11+:
The spray moves left and right in a "T" shape. At this point, you should stop firing and reset. A Note on "No Recoil" Scripts You may find scripts online that use the command or external "no recoil" executables. Often feel clunky and interfere with your normal aiming. Executables (.exe): These are considered
and will get you banned by VAC (Valve Anti-Cheat) or third-party services like FastCup or ESEA. Autoexec.cfg
template that includes these performance and network optimizations? Follow-up: Are you playing on or a specific community mod like Warzone?
A "No Recoil" config (CFG) for Counter-Strike 1.6 is a text file containing specialized console commands that aim to minimize the vertical and horizontal spray of weapons—specifically the AK-47—by forcing client-side settings, such as forcing mouse movement downward or setting view angles. ⚠️ Disclaimer: Anti-Cheat Warning
Using No Recoil CFGs on protected servers (VAC, EAC, Faceit, FastCup) is considered cheating and will likely result in a permanent ban
. These scripts are designed for offline practice or non-protected servers. 1. The Ultimate AK-47 No Recoil CFG Structure
This configuration focuses on minimizing recoil through network optimization, rate adjustments, and weapon accuracy commands. Create a new text file, paste this, and save it as norecoil.cfg
// --- AK-47 No Recoil / Anti-Recoil Config --- // Created for Counter-Strike 1.6
// 1. Network Settings (Ensures smooth, accurate registration) rate "100000" cl_cmdrate "105" cl_updaterate "102" ex_interp "0.01" // Use 0.1 for high ping cl_lc "1" cl_lw "1" In Counter-Strike 1
// 2. Weapon & Mouse Sensitivity Tweaks sensitivity "2.0" // Adjust to your preference m_rawinput "1" // Uses direct mouse input m_filter "0" // Disables mouse smoothing cl_dynamiccrosshair "0" // Static crosshair for better aim
// 3. The "No Recoil" Commands (Anti-Recoil) // These commands aim to keep the gun steady cl_bob "0" cl_bobup "0" cl_bobcycle "0" // Force view angles (reduces upward jump) m_pitch "0.022" m_yaw "0.022"
// 4. Viewmodel & Recoil Optimization r_drawviewmodel "1" cl_crosshair_size "small" cl_crosshair_translucent "0"
// --- End of Config --- echo "--- AK-47 No Recoil CFG Loaded ---" Use code with caution. Copied to clipboard 2. Detailed Explanation of Commands m_rawinput 1
: The most important command. It bypasses Windows mouse acceleration, ensuring your mouse movement directly controls the in-game view. cl_dynamiccrosshair 0
: Prevents the crosshair from expanding while moving or firing, helping you focus on the center. ex_interp 0.01
: Sets the interpolation, providing smoother player models and more precise hit registration on low-ping servers.
: Eliminates the gun movement animation while running, providing a steadier visual to aim. rate 100000 cl_updaterate 102
: Ensures the server sends maximum data to your client, reducing "ghost" bullets. 3. Implementation Steps (How to Use) Locate Folder : Go to your Counter-Strike directory (usually Steam\steamapps\common\Half-Life\cstrike \cstrike_downloads for non-steam). Create File : Right-click -> New -> Text Document. Name it norecoil.cfg : Open with Notepad, paste the code above, and save. Execute In-Game : Open the console ( key) and type: exec norecoil.cfg 4. Alternative: The "Legit" Method (No CFG)
True "no recoil" is impossible without scripts, but you can achieve near-zero recoil with proper techniques: Tap Firing
: The first 1-2 shots of the AK-47 in 1.6 are nearly perfectly accurate.
: Fire 3-4 bullets at a time, then stop briefly to let the recoil reset. : If you must spray, move your mouse down immediately upon firing, as the 1.6 AK-47 jumps severely. 5. Essential Enhancements hud_fastswitch 1 : Enables fast weapon switching. fps_override 1 fps_max 100
: Ensures stable FPS, which directly affects how the game handles recoil. No legal console command ( cl_pitchspeed , cl_pitchdown
Note: For the best results, use these settings on a local server ( map de_dust2 ) to practice against bots first.
Counter-Strike 1.6, a no-recoil configuration (CFG) typically refers to a script or collection of console commands designed to minimize the upward and horizontal kick of weapons like the AK-47. These scripts often work by automatically pulling the player's view downward ( ) or adjusting pitch speeds while the fire button is held. Common Components of a No-Recoil CFG
A standard AK-47 "no-recoil" setup in a CFG file often includes the following types of scripts: Anti-Recoil Aliases : These bind the primary fire button ( ) to a custom command that activates both
simultaneously, effectively countering the vertical climb of the weapon. Pitch Speed Adjustments : Commands like cl_pitchspeed
are sometimes manipulated within aliases to control the speed at which the crosshair moves downward to match specific weapon spray patterns. Visual Optimization : Settings like cl_dynamiccrosshair 0
are frequently included to keep the crosshair static, making it easier to track the center of a spray manually. Example Script Structure
Based on community guides, a basic no-recoil toggle might look like this:
alias +rshoot "+attack; +lookdown" alias -rshoot "-attack; -lookdown" alias norecoil_on "bind mouse1 +rshoot; echo Anti-Recoil Active" alias norecoil_off "bind mouse1 +attack; echo Normal Mode" bind "v" "norecoil_on" // Toggle key Copied to clipboard Scribd CS Config Guide Legality and Competitive Play
While these scripts do not modify the game's internal code like a "hack" (e.g., an EXE aimbot), they are generally prohibited in competitive environments: Server Protection
: Many modern servers use anti-cheat plugins like HLDS or VAC to detect rapid command execution or illegal aliases. Competitive Bans
: In most leagues and professional play, using "no-recoil" aliases is considered a bannable offense as it automates a core skill—recoil management. Mechanical Alternative
: High-level players typically recommend mastering the "pull-down" method manually—dragging the mouse down for the first five bullets and then slightly left for the next three. legal configuration settings
used by professional players to optimize performance without scripts? How to Control the AK 47 Spray in CS2
Searching for "CS 1.6 AK-47 no recoil cfg" often leads to:
// ak47_optimized.cfg
rate "25000"
cl_cmdrate "101"
cl_updaterate "101"
ex_interp "0.01"
cl_lc "1"
cl_lw "1" // Keep enabled for accurate recoil display